Visibility & Growth Mechanics (Non-Technical)
For a Virtual Assistant in Birmingham, online visibility is not about "being on the internet"âit is about search intent mapping.
There are two types of users you must attract: those with informational intent and those with transactional intent.
Informational intent users are searching for "how to delegate tasks" or "benefits of a remote assistant." By providing these answers on your website, you build a relationship before they are even ready to hire. Transactional intent users are searching directly for a Virtual Assistant in Birmingham. Your website must be architected to meet both needs, moving the customer through a journey from initial discovery to absolute trust.
In the competitive landscape of Birmingham, visibility is a zero-sum game. If a competitor's website ranks higher, they are effectively intercepting your potential revenue. Growth mechanics involve consistently updating your digital asset to reflect the evolving needs of the West Midlands business community, ensuring that your brand remains the top-of-mind solution.
Service Execution Framework (Insight-Driven)
When engaging a Website Designing Service, a Virtual Assistant in Birmingham should expect more than just a "pretty site." The framework must include:
Logical Information Architecture: Navigating your services should be intuitive. If a client can't find your pricing or contact info in 5 seconds, they will leave.
Conversion-Centric Design: Every page should have a single goal, whether itâs signing up for a newsletter or booking a consultation.
Speed and Security: A slow site suggests a slow assistant. Technical excellence reflects your professional standards.
Common mistakes include using generic stock photos that don't represent the Birmingham area or failing to optimize for mobile users. Sustainable results look like a steady climb in organic inquiries over 6â12 months, rather than the "sugar high" of a short-term social media ad campaign.
Cost vs ROI Perspective for Virtual Assistant
Investing in a Website Designing Service is a shift from an expense mindset to a growth asset mindset. For a Virtual Assistant in Birmingham, the ROI is often realized within the first two high-value clients.
Typically, a professional digital presence pays for itself through:
Rate Increases: A professional site justifies "Premium" pricing.
Time Savings: Automated onboarding and FAQs save hours of manual explanation.
Client Longevity: Professionalism attracts corporate clients who stay for years, not weeks.
Tracking ROI involves monitoring lead conversion rates and the "Customer Acquisition Cost" (CAC). For a localized Virtual Assistant in Birmingham, the CAC via a well-designed website is significantly lower than traditional advertising over the long term.

Questions Clients Commonly Ask
How long does it take to see results from a new website?
Initial indexing by search engines takes a few days, but for a Virtual Assistant in Birmingham to see significant organic traffic, it typically takes 3 to 6 months of consistent SEO effort. However, the conversion benefitsâwhere you send a referral to your site and they hire you immediatelyâare instantaneous.
Will a professional website really help me charge higher rates?
Yes. Professionalism reduces perceived risk. When a client sees a bespoke, high-quality website, they perceive you as a high-value partner rather than a low-cost commodity.
This allows a Virtual Assistant in Birmingham to move away from "per-hour" pricing toward "value-based" packages.
Do I need to be tech-savvy to manage my own website?
Modern Website Designing Services focus on user-friendly interfaces. Most solutions for a Virtual Assistant in Birmingham are built so that you can easily update your services, blog posts, or pricing without needing to write a single line of code.
Is a website better than a LinkedIn profile for a Virtual Assistant?
They serve different purposes. LinkedIn is for networking; your website is for closing. A website gives you 100% control over the branding and user experience, which LinkedIn does not. It is the only platform where you aren't one click away from a competitor's profile.
